Programing CD tracks

— Program Play

You can make a program of up to 25 tracks in the
order you want them to be played.

Press ENTER.
The track is programed.
"STEP" appears, followed by the selection
number. The last programed track number
appears, followed by the total playing time of
the program. If you have made a mistake,
you can clear the last programed track from
the program by pressing CLEAR.
5
To program additional tracks, repeat
steps 3 and 4.
6
Press N.
Program Play starts.
All the tracks play in the order you selected.
To check the total number of
programed tracks
Press DISPLAY in stop mode. The total number
of programed steps appears, followed by the last
programed track number and the total playing time
of the program.
